How Our Team Handles Rental Property Water Damage Restoration
Our team follows a rigorous process to ensure that your rental property is restored to its original condition. We understand the importance of acting quickly to prevent further damage, which is why we respond to emergencies 24/7. Our process typically begins within 60 minutes of your initial call, and we work tirelessly to complete the restoration within 3-5 days.
Step 1: Emergency Response
Our team responds to your emergency call within 60 minutes, equipped with the necessary equipment to assess the damage and begin the restoration process. We use moisture meters to detect hidden water damage and pr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our technicians use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ract water from the affected area, removing up to 2 inches of standing water in a single pass.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the affected area, reducing humidity levels to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ning
Our team uses antimicrobial treatments to sanitize the affected area, removing any remaining bacteria, viruses, or mold spores. We also thoroughly clean and disinfect all surfaces to prevent further damage.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Our technicians work with you to restore your rental property to its original condition, repairing any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ings. We also replace any damaged materials, such as drywall, carpeting, or flooring.

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health risks. Look out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your rental property can show h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ent mold growth.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age beneath the surface.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a leak or burst pipe.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.
Unexplained Puddles or Water Spots
Unexplained puddles or water spots on your rental property can show hidden water damage. If you notice any unusual water spots,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Unpleasant Mold Growth
Mold growth in your rental property can show hidden water damage. If you notice any mold growth,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ent health risks.
